Transaction 3581eefac29da4e7492f315e1789412ec4748145d0ac012bd5eb36f3fba56655

2 Input
2 Outputs
  • 3581eefac29da4e7492f315e1789412ec4748145d0ac012bd5eb36f3fba56655:0
  • value  15216820
    address  1F8YFFt91SwXtj1Xv7hV6fMx614YES8nSr
  • 3581eefac29da4e7492f315e1789412ec4748145d0ac012bd5eb36f3fba56655:1
  • value  1631158
    address  1MkiJ3j9GRYUo7a9Rzi3PXjUZfuuSHTePo